Job description
Join our premier Seattle based sports academy as a Senior Sports Coach. You will lead and inspire athletes across youth and competitive programs, delivering high-impact training that builds skill, confidence, and teamwork.
As a member of our coaching team, you will design evidence-based practice sessions, monitor athlete safety, track progress, and collaborate with parents, school partners, and performance staff to ensure every athlete reaches their potential.
We value coaching excellence, safety, and a growth mindset. This role offers competitive compensation, professional development, and a supportive culture that rewards initiative and leadership.
Responsibility
- Design and implement comprehensive training plans aligned with program goals and individual needs.
- Lead engaging 60 to 90 minute practice sessions for youth and competitive athletes across football and multisport activities.
- Assess technical skills, fitness, and tactical understanding; provide actionable feedback and progress tracking.
- Ensure athlete safety through proper warmups, injury prevention, equipment checks, and emergency readiness.
- Coach across multiple sports, adapting drills to age groups and skill levels while maintaining high standards of performance.
- Collaborate with parents, school partners, and performance staff to communicate progress, scheduling, and expectations.
- Motivate, mentor, and develop assistant coaches and volunteers while upholding the academy's culture and values.
Qualification
- Relevant coaching certifications (e.g., USSF/US Soccer, NATA, NASM, or equivalent) and current First Aid/CPR certification.
- Minimum 3 years of coaching experience with youth and/or competitive athletes in football or multisport settings.
- Proven ability to plan, deliver, and adjust training based on athlete data and feedback.
- Strong communication, leadership, and relationship-building skills with athletes, parents, and partners.
- Ability to manage multiple groups, schedule sessions, and maintain accurate progress records.
- Commitment to safety, inclusion, and a positive coaching philosophy that fosters growth.
- Eligibility to work in the United States and the ability to pass background checks and clearances.
